Defining the B1 Level: What Does "Intermediate" Mean?
The CEFR divides language efficiency into 6 levels, varying from A1 (Beginner) to C2 (Mastery). At the B1 level, a learner is no longer just reciting memorized phrases; they are starting to navigate the language with a degree of self-reliance.

An individual at the B1 level can typically:
Understand the bottom lines of clear, standard input on familiar matters frequently experienced in work, school, and leisure.Deal with many scenarios most likely to develop while taking a trip in an area where the language is spoken.Produce simple connected text on subjects that recognize or of personal interest.Describe experiences, events, dreams, hopes, and aspirations, and briefly give factors and descriptions for opinions and strategies.Table 1: CEFR Proficiency OverviewLevelClassificationDescriptionA1 - A2Standard UserCan interact in easy, everyday jobs.B1 - B2Independent UserCan browse most circumstances and express viewpoints.C1 - C2Proficient UserCan comprehend complicated texts and speak with complete confidence.Why Pursue a B1 Certificate?

1. Citizenship and Residency
In numerous countries, a B1 certificate is a legal requirement for naturalization or permanent residency. For circumstances, the UK Home Office needs a B1 English certificate (such as SELT) for citizenship applications. Similarly, Germany needs a B1 level in German (Deutsch-Test für Zuwanderer) for those seeking to end up being residents.
2. Work Opportunities
While high-level executive roles might need C1 efficiency, many occupation tasks, hospitality roles, and administrative positions accept B1-level candidates. It demonstrates that the employee can follow guidelines, interact with customers, and participate in standard workplace conferences.
3. Vocational Training and Education
Lots of trade colleges and preparatory courses for universities (Studienkolleg) need a B1 certificate as an entry limit. It guarantees the trainee can follow lectures and take part in class discussions.
The Components of a B1 Exam
While various service providers (like Cambridge, Goethe-Institut, DELF, or IELTS) have slightly various formats, most B1 assessments are divided into four core modules.
The Reading Module
Candidates are needed to check out different texts, such as blog posts, news article, ads, and official guidelines. They must recognize both basic styles and particular details.
Period: Approximately 65-- 90 minutes.Task Types: Multiple choice, matching, and true/false.The Listening Module
This area evaluates the ability to understand spoken language in various contexts, such as an announcement at a train station, a radio interview, or a casual conversation in between friends.
Duration: Approximately 30-- 40 minutes.Key Challenge: Understanding different accents and filtering background sound.The Writing Module

This is often considered the most stressful part. Prospects generally perform this in pairs or individually with an examiner.
Jobs: A short presentation on a familiar topic, a conversation with a partner to prepare an event, and a quick interview about individual interests.Examination: Fluency, pronunciation, and the capability to communicate.Popular B1 Certification Exams by Language
Depending on the language being studied, the name and service provider of the certificate will vary.
Table 2: Common B1 ExaminationsLanguageCertificate NameAwarding BodyEnglishFAMILY PET (Preliminary English Test)Cambridge AssessmentEnglishIELTS (Score 4.0 - 5.0)British Council/ IDPGermanGoethe-Zertifikat B1Goethe-InstitutFrenchDELF B1France Éducation InternationalSpanishDELE B1Instituto CervantesItalianCILS Uno-B1University of SienaPreparation Strategies for Success

Using ports like "although," "because," "therefore," and "in addition" assists show the required level of complexity.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)How long does it require to reach the B1 level?
On average, it takes approximately 350 to 500 guided discovering hours to reach B1 from a total beginner start. This varies based on the learner's previous experience and the intensity of research study.
Does a B1 certificate end?
Most B1 certificates (like the Goethe-[Zertifikat B1 Telc](https://notes.io/ecu3J) or DELF) do not have a formal expiration date. Nevertheless, for migration functions, lots of federal governments need the certificate to be no older than two to five years.
Is the B1 test difficult?
The B1 exam is tough but fair. It is created to test useful communication instead of obscure grammatical rules. If a prospect can browse a conversation in the target language about their daily life, they are likely ready for B1.
Can I take the modules individually?
This depends on the test service provider. For example, the Goethe B1 German test allows prospects to take Reading, Writing, Listening, and Speaking as 4 independent modules. If a prospect stops working one, they just need to retake that particular part.
What is the passing score?
Usually, a rating of 60% throughout all modules is needed to pass. Some exams require a minimum rating in each module to be granted the general certificate.
